Vanwell, 1989, Vg/Vg, 160 p., ill. bw photos, 28 cm. bibliography and index. Merchant ships fom the Boer war to the Falklands large passenger ships have been used as troopships, auxiliary cruisers, hospital ships, commerce raiders, depot ships and aircraft carriers in times of war. The ships were often given a razzle paint job to make them less visible at a distance on the horizon.
